Government must release R$ 2 million to Angra dos Reis

The federal government should announce this Monday (4th) the release of R$ 2 million for assistance and relief to victims of heavy rains that punished the state of Rio de Janeiro over the weekend.

The amount will be directed to Angra dos Reis, one of the most affected municipalities.

THE CNN found that this amount refers to the first resource requested by the city hall and came out of the Civil Defense budget.

The expectation is that the announcement will be made after the visit of President Jair Bolsonaro to the affected areas. According to reports made to CNNBolsonaro should fly over the affected areas this Monday.

So far, four cities in Rio de Janeiro are in a state of emergency, at least 17 people have died and 5,000 are homeless.

In Angra dos Reis, the Ministry of Regional Development recognized the emergency situation. This allows accelerating the release of aid to the municipality. To guarantee this aid, municipalities need to apply through the Civil Defense system.
